Understanding the Power of Hydro Jetting
Hydro jetting, also known as water jetting or sewer jetting, is a highly effective method for clearing stubborn blockages in your home’s plumbing system. Unlike traditional snaking methods that may only create a temporary hole in a clog, hydro jetting uses high-pressure water to completely obliterate and flush away obstructions. This process is particularly effective for organic buildup, grease, soap scum, and even tree roots that have infiltrated your sewer lines. The power of pressurized water ensures a thorough cleaning, leaving your pipes remarkably clear and preventing future problems.
How Local Professionals Perform Hydro Jetting
When you connect with a local South Bay Estates plumber through USA Plumbing Directory, you can expect a professional and systematic approach to hydro jetting. The process typically involves the following steps:
- Inspection: Before hydro jetting, a plumber will often perform a video camera inspection of your sewer lines. This allows them to identify the exact location and nature of the blockage, ensuring the most effective approach.
- Accessing the Line: The technician will access the main sewer line, usually through a cleanout access point.
- Introducing the Hydro Jetter: A specialized hose with a hydro jetting nozzle is inserted into the pipe.
- Applying High-Pressure Water: The plumber then channels water at extremely high pressures – often between 1,500 and 4,000 PSI – through the nozzle. The nozzle is designed to spray water in multiple directions, effectively scouring the inside of the pipe and breaking down the clog.
- Flushing the Debris: As the clog is disintegrated, the high-pressure water flushes the debris downstream, leaving the pipe clear and clean.
- Post-Jetting Camera Inspection: In many cases, a follow-up camera inspection is performed to confirm that the line is completely clear and free of any remaining obstructions.
The “materials or methods commonly used” in hydro jetting primarily revolve around the specialized equipment. This includes industrial-grade hydro jetting machines capable of generating immense water pressure, flexible hoses designed to navigate bends in the pipe, and specialized nozzles that can direct the water flow for maximum cleaning power. The primary “material” is, of course, water, but its application under extreme pressure is what makes this service so transformative.

Frequently Asked Questions About Hydro Jetting
How long does a hydro jetting service typically take in South Bay Estates?
The duration of a hydro jetting service can vary depending on the severity and location of the clog, as well as the complexity of your home’s plumbing system. For most residential applications in areas like South Bay Estates, a typical hydro jetting service can take anywhere from 1 to 4 hours.
Are hydro jetting services safe for older homes in South Bay Estates?
Generally, hydro jetting is safe for most plumbing systems, including older ones, provided the pipes are in good condition. A professional plumber will always start with a camera inspection to assess the integrity of your pipes before proceeding with hydro jetting. They can determine if your older pipes are robust enough to withstand the high pressure, ensuring no damage occurs.
What is the difference between snaking and hydro jetting?
Snaking, or drain augering, uses a mechanical cable to break through a clog, often creating a temporary opening. Hydro jetting, on the other hand, uses high-pressure water to completely scour and flush away the entire blockage and any accumulated buildup within the pipe, offering a more thorough and long-lasting solution.
